Authors [Ref. No.] | Year | Country | Number of Hips (No Screw/Screw) | Age (SD; Years) (No Screw/Screw) | Surgical Approach | Materials of Acetabular Cup | Femoral Stem/Femoral Head/Liner | Follow-Up Period (Years) |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Thanner et al. [13] | 2000 | Sweden | 34/30 | 56 (10.8)/56 (10.8) | Modified Hardinge | Titanium fiber–metal cup | Uncemented; cemented/ceramic; cobalt-chrome/PE | 2 |
Otten et al. [8,14] | 2015 | Sweden | 17/17 | 55 (6.5)/56 (6.3) | Posterolateral | Porous-coated titanium alloy cup | Cemented; cementless/ceramic/PE | 14 |
Minten et al. [11,12] | 2016 | The Netherlands | 19/17 | 69 (8.4)/70 (5.5) | Posterolateral | All polyethylene, press-fit cup with titanium coating | Cementless/ceramic/PE | 6.5 |
Howie et al. [10] | 2020 | Australia | 35/31 | 58 (5.8)/57 (5.3) | Posterior | Tantalum trabecular metal (no screw)/titanium fiber-metal (screw) | Cemented/cobalt-chrome/PE | 2 |
Outcomes | No. of Participants (No. of RCTs) | Certainty of the Evidence (GRADE) | RR (95% CI) | Anticipated Absolute Effects |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Risk with Screw | Risk Difference without Screw | ||||
Reoperation | 183 (4) | ⨁◯◯◯* Very low a,b,c | 0.98 (0.14–6.68) | 22 per 1000 | 0 fewer per 1000 (19 fewer to 128 more) |
Migration of acetabular cup | 140 (3)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| 1.72 (0.29–10.33) | 15 per 1000 | 11 more per 1000 (11 fewer to 141 more) |
Harris Hip Score | 162 (4)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| Mean range, 89–99 | MD 1.19 higher (1.31 lower to 3.7 higher) | |
Radiolucent line | 57 (1)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| 5.91 (0.32–109.35) | 0 per 1000 | 0 fewer per 1000 (0 fewer to 0 fewer) |
Cup translation: medial–lateral | 153 (4)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| Mean range, −0.09–0.58 | MD 0.08 lower (0.34 lower to 0.19 higher) | |
distal–proximal | 153 (4)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| Mean range, 0.12–0.29 | MD 0.01 lower (0.15 lower to 0.12 higher) | |
anterior–posterior | 153 (4)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| Mean range, −0.02–0.81 | MD 0.19 lower (0.52 lower to 0.13 higher) | |
transverse | 153 (4)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| Mean range, 0.13–1.32 | MD 0.25 lower (1.1 lower to 0.59 higher) | |
longitudinal | 153 (4)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| Mean range, −0.14–1.52 | MD 0.43 lower (1.44 lower to 0.58 higher) | |
sagittal | 153 (4)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| Mean range, −0.13–1.06 | MD 0.16 lower (0.73 lower to 0.4 higher) | |
Polyethylene wear | 87 (3) | ⨁◯◯◯ Very low a,b,c | Mean range, 0.07–0.19 | MD 0.01 higher
(0.01 lower to 0.04 higher) |
